Eid ul Fitr 2025: No challans for tourists
To ensure a smooth travel experience for visitors during the Eidul Fitr holidays, the Abbottabad Traffic Police have announced a three-day suspension of traffic challans. During this period, challan devices will remain inactive, ensuring that no tourist is fined.
The decision was taken in a high-level meeting held on Thursday, where officials discussed special traffic management strategies for Eid. DSP Headquarters, DSP Traffic, DSP Mandian, DSP Havelian, Inspector Traffic, and senior police officers, including those from the Main Control Room and Traffic Control Room, were present at the meeting.
Traffic Plan for Eid
SSP Traffic Warden Tariq Mahmood Khan stated that to manage the holiday rush, all traffic police personnel would remain on duty, as official leaves have been canceled.
Additionally, special facilitation centers will be set up to assist tourists, ensuring they do not face any difficulties during their visit.
Emphasizing discipline and professionalism, SSP Tariq Mahmood directed officers to maintain respectful behavior towards tourists and the public. He warned that any misconduct or rude behavior would not be tolerated, and officers must ensure smooth traffic flow to prevent congestion.
Public Assistance and Safety Measures
Traffic police personnel will be strategically deployed across the city to assist citizens in case of emergencies. Authorities have urged the public to follow traffic rules and cooperate with law enforcement for a hassle-free and enjoyable Eid experience.
